In Anticipation of Islamabad Talks: Oil Prices Edge Lower as Hopes for Middle East Supply Recovery Resurface

 Oil prices saw a notable decline in Tuesday's trading, April 21, 2026, with Brent crude losing about 1% to settle at $94.53 per barrel. This dip is driven by expectations of resumed peace talks between Washington and Tehran in Pakistan, which could pave the way for lifting restrictions on Iranian energy exports and increasing global supply. WTI crude futures also fell by 1.72% to reach $88.07, as markets closely watch the outcome of the upcoming diplomatic round and its impact on the stability of international shipping lanes.
